Movement is jumpy
I'm using this cable with the 2016 13" MacBook Pro. The image looks clear, but for large movement such as moving a window around it is very jumpy. One monitor is connected using apple's HDMI adaptor and its just fine. In displays, the HDMI says 60 Hertz, but the monitor with this cable says 59.88 Hertz (NTSC), not sure why different.
